What is Beaver Dammer?
1.
a term synonymous with "cock block" however only applying to women that prevent another woman from "scoring" with a target of intimate interest
"I was totally gonna go home with that guy till that beaver dammer screwed it up"
"i totally got beaver dammed by that slut!"
See
Random Words:
1.
The process of shattering misguided/idiotic ideas and thoughts by using the all-powerful, all-knowing Google search.
Ann: I'm gonn..